Contingency Theory: Adapting Leadership Styles to Specific Situations

The level of task structure refers to how well-defined and clear the tasks are. In highly structured situations, where tasks are straightforward and routine, a laissez-faire or hands-off leadership style might work. In contrast, in situations with low task structure, where tasks are ambiguous and complex, a more directive leadership style may be needed.

Situational Leadership: Tailoring Your Approach to Each Situation

Situational Leadership is a dynamic leadership model that emphasizes the need to adapt leadership styles based on the readiness or maturity of team members and the demands of the task. It involves four leadership styles: directing, coaching, supporting, and delegating. The key is to recognize where each team member falls on the readiness scale and adjust leadership style accordingly. Situational Leadership enhances productivity, strengthens relationships within teams, and encourages professional growth. However, it requires leaders to be perceptive and empathetic and demands time and effort to assess readiness and adapt styles.
